Test Driven Design meets Design by Contract by Jim Weirich

Test-driven Development, although not ubiquitous, certainly has made a strong impact on the software industry. However, there has been some criticism of TDD. Advocates of Behavior-driven Design suggest that the testing-oriented vocabulary of TDD causes developers to focus on the wrong aspects of development. Rather than thinking about testing, developers …

Continuous Integration: Improving Software Quality and Reducing Risk – Part 1

Duvall and Glover discuss their Jolt Award winning book, Continuous Integration: Improving Software Quality and Reducing Risk and illustrates how to transform integration from a necessary evil into an everyday part of the development process. http://www.informit.com/podcasts/episode.aspx?e=15b157da-8f9e-4613-a75d-03d2e6d0bbde Related material: Continuous Integration: Improving Software Quality and Reducing Risk (Book Review) Continuous Integration: …